Tomorrow’s Weather Forecast: A Detailed Outlook

The meteorological authority has issued a detailed report on the expected weather conditions for tomorrow, Friday, warning of significant temperature variations between day and night. Expect a cold start to the day, transitioning to milder temperatures during daylight hours with sunshine, before a sharp and sudden temperature drop in the evening across the country. This necessitates careful consideration when choosing your attire.

Visibility Concerns: Fog and Dust

Dense fog is anticipated in the early morning hours on agricultural and highway roads, particularly those leading to and from Greater Cairo, the Nile Delta, and northern Upper Egypt. Drivers should exercise extreme caution. The forecast also warns of suspended dust particles during the day in areas of Cairo and the Nile Delta. Furthermore, strong winds, potentially raising sand and dust, are expected along the northwestern coast and the Western Desert, which could reduce horizontal visibility.

Rainfall Prospects

Light, intermittent rainfall is possible in scattered areas of the northwestern coast and southern Sinai. Overall, fluctuating winter weather conditions are expected to persist.

Sea Conditions

The Mediterranean Sea will be moderately to rough, with wave heights ranging from 1.5 to 2.5 meters and southwesterly surface winds. Fishermen and those engaging in marine activities should be cautious. The Red Sea is expected to remain stable and moderate, with wave heights not exceeding two meters and surface winds ranging from southeasterly to northwesterly.
